ST72101/ST72212/ST72213
8-BIT MCU WITH 4 TO 8K ROM/OTP/EPROM,
256 BYTES RAM, ADC, WDG, SPI AND 1 OR 2 TIMERS
DATASHEET
s User Program Memory (ROM/OTP/EPROM):
4 to 8K bytes
s Data RAM: 256 bytes, including 64 bytes of
stack
s Master Reset and Power-On Reset
s Run, Wait, Slow, Halt and RAM Retention
modes
s 22 multifunctional bidirectional I/O lines:
– 22 programmable interrupt inputs
– 8 high sink outputs
– 6 analog alternate inputs
– 10 to 14 alternate functions
– EMI filtering
s Programmable watchdog (WDG)
s One or two 16-bit Timers, each featuring:
– 2 Input Captures
– 2 Output Compares
– External Clock input (on Timer A only)
– PWM and Pulse Generator modes
s Synchronous Serial Peripheral Interface (SPI)
s 8-bit Analog-to-Digital converter (6 channels)
(ST72212 and ST72213 only)
s 8-bit Data Manipulation
s 63 Basic Instructions
s 17 main Addressing Modes
s 8 x 8 Unsigned Multiply Instruction
s True Bit Manipulation
s Complete Development Support on PC/DOS-
WINDOWSTM Real-Time Emulator
s Full Software Package on DOS/WINDOWSTM
(C-Compiler, Cross-Assembler, Debugger)
